/dev/null +++ b/Qemu.md @@ -0,0 +1,203 @@ +# SW:Ubuntu Asahi Qemu + +Tested on Ubuntu 22.10 Asahi on M1 Air. + +Other Ubuntu Asahi install info at https://github.com/AsahiLinux/docs/wiki/SW%3AAlternative-Distros + +Also installs virt-manager. + +Slirp included when compiling, to have user networking: +https://bugs.launchpad.net/qemu/+bug/1917161 + +``` +sudo apt -y install git libglib2.0-dev libfdt-dev \ +libpixman-1-dev zlib1g-dev ninja-build \ +git-email libaio-dev libbluetooth-dev \ +libcapstone-dev libbrlapi-dev libbz2-dev \ +libcap-ng-dev libcurl4-gnutls-dev libgtk-3-dev \ +libibverbs-dev libjpeg8-dev libncurses5-dev \ +libnuma-dev librbd-dev librdmacm-dev \ +libsasl2-dev libsdl2-dev libseccomp-dev \ +libsnappy-dev libssh-dev \ +libvde-dev libvdeplug-dev libvte-2.91-dev \ +libxen-dev liblzo2-dev valgrind xfslibs-dev \ +libnfs-dev libiscsi-dev flex bison meson \ +qemu-utils virt-manager + +git clone https://gitlab.com/qemu-project/qemu.git + +cd qemu + +git submodule init + +git submodule update + +git clone https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/slirp/libslirp + +cd libslirp + +meson build + +ninja -C build install + +cd .. + +mkdir build + +cd build + +../configure --enable-slirp + +make -j$(nproc) + +sudo make install +``` + +## Networking examples for various OS + +https://wiki.qemu.org/Documentation/Networking + +## ReactOS x86 32bit with networking + +https://reactos.org + +``` +wget reactos-32bit-bootcd-nightly.7z + +7z x reactos-32bit-bootcd-nightly.7z + +mv reactos*.iso ReactOS.iso +``` +20G is max growable disk size here: +``` +qemu-img create -f qcow2 ReactOS.qcow2 20G +``` +Here `-m 3G` is 3 GB RAM. + +Edit `start.sh` and set it executeable `chmod +x start.sh` with this content: +``` +qemu-system-i386 -m 3G -drive if=ide,index=0,media=disk,file=ReactOS.qcow2 \ +-drive if=ide,index=2,media=cdrom,file=ReactOS.iso -boot order=d \ +-serial stdio -netdev user,id=n0 -device rtl8139,netdev=n0 +``` +Then run `./start.sh` + +## WinXP x86 32bit with networking + +1) Create growable harddisk image of 80 GB: +``` +qemu-img create -f qcow2 winxp.qcow2 80G +``` +2) Start install from winxp.iso + +Edit `start.sh` and set it executeable `chmod +x start.sh`, here `-m 4G` is 4 GB RAM: +``` +qemu-system-i386 -m 4G -drive if=ide,index=0,media=disk,file=winxp.qcow2 \ +-drive if=ide,index=2,media=cdrom,file=winxp.iso -boot order=d \ +-serial stdio -netdev user,id=n0 -device rtl8139,netdev=n0 +``` +3) After install, boot without iso +``` +qemu-system-i386 -m 4G -drive if=ide,index=0,media=disk,file=winxp.qcow2 \ +-boot order=c \ +-serial stdio -netdev user,id=n0 -device rtl8139,netdev=n0 +``` + +## Win10 x86_64 with networking + +1) Create growable harddisk image of 80 GB: +``` +qemu-img create -f qcow2 win10.qcow2 80G +``` +2) Start install from win10.iso + +Edit `start.sh` and set it executeable `chmod +x start.sh`, here `-m 4G` is 4 GB RAM: +``` +qemu-system-x86_64 -m 4G -drive if=ide,index=0,media=disk,file=win10.qcow2 \ +-drive if=ide,index=2,media=cdrom,file=win10.iso -boot order=d \ +-serial stdio -netdev user,id=n0 -device rtl8139,netdev=n0 +``` +3) After install, boot without iso +``` +qemu-system-x86_64 -m 4G -drive if=ide,index=0,media=disk,file=win10.qcow2 \ +-boot order=c \ +-serial stdio -netdev user,id=n0 -device rtl8139,netdev=n0 +``` + +## Win11 x86_64 with networking + +1) Create growable harddisk image of 80 GB: +``` +qemu-img create -f qcow2 win11.qcow2 80G +``` +2) Start
